  16. Finding out about filling-in: A guide to perceptual completion for visual science and the philosophy of perception.Luiz Pessoa, Evan Thompson & Alva Noë - 1998 - Behavioral and Brain Sciences 21 (6):723-748.
    In visual science the term filling-inis used in different ways, which often leads to confusion. This target article presents a taxonomy of perceptual completion phenomena to organize and clarify theoretical and empirical discussion. Examples of boundary completion (illusory contours) and featural completion (color, brightness, motion, texture, and depth) are examined, and single-cell studies relevant to filling-in are reviewed and assessed.   30. Ways of coloring.Evan Thompson, A. Palacios & F. J. Varela - 1992 - Behavioral and Brain Sciences 15 (1):1-26.
    Different explanations of color vision favor different philosophical positions: Computational vision is more compatible with objectivism (the color is in the object), psychophysics and neurophysiology with subjectivism (the color is in the head). Comparative research suggests that an explanation of color must be both experientialist (unlike objectivism) and ecological (unlike subjectivism). Computational vision's emphasis on optimally prespecified features of the environment (i.e., distal properties, independent of the sensory-motor capacities of the animal) is unsatisfactory.   40. Colour vision, evolution, and perceptual content.Evan Thompson - 1995 - Synthese 104 (1):1-32.
    b>. Computational models of colour vision assume that the biological function of colour vision is to detect surface reflectance. Some philosophers invoke these models as a basis for 'externalism' about perceptual content (content is distal) and 'objectivism' about colour (colour is surface reflectance).   43. Brain in a Vat or Body in a World? Brainbound versus Enactive Views of Experience.Evan Thompson & Diego Cosmelli - 2011 - Philosophical Topics 39 (1):163-180.
    We argue that the minimal biological requirements for consciousness include a living body, not just neuronal processes in the skull. Our argument proceeds by reconsidering the brain-in-a-vat thought experiment. Careful examination of this thought experiment indicates that the null hypothesis is that any adequately functional “vat” would be a surrogate body, that is, that the so-called vat would be no vat at all, but rather an embodied agent in the world.
